编程和工程师有什么联系
-
编程和工程师有着密切的联系。编程是指将问题转化为计算机能够理解和执行的指令的过程,而工程师则是指通过应用科学和数学知识来解决实际问题的专业人士。在现代社会中,计算机技术和软件应用已经成为各行各业不可或缺的一部分,因此编程技能对于工程师来说至关重要。
首先,编程为工程师提供了解决问题的工具。无论是在机械工程、电子工程、化学工程还是土木工程等领域,工程师都需要设计和开发各种软件应用来辅助他们的工作。通过编程,工程师可以编写程序来模拟和分析复杂的系统,优化设计参数,进行数据处理和可视化等。编程技能使工程师能够更高效地完成工作,提高工作质量和效率。
其次,编程能够帮助工程师实现自动化和智能化。随着科技的不断发展,越来越多的工程任务需要依赖计算机和软件来完成。工程师可以利用编程技能开发控制系统、自动化设备和智能算法,使工程过程更加智能化和自动化。例如,在制造业中,工程师可以编写程序来控制机器人进行自动化生产;在交通领域,工程师可以开发智能交通系统来优化交通流量和路况。编程技能使工程师能够将传统工程与现代科技相结合,创造出更加智能和高效的解决方案。
此外,编程还为工程师提供了学习和创新的平台。编程是一门不断进化和发展的技术,工程师可以通过学习和应用不同的编程语言和工具来不断提升自己的技能。工程师可以利用编程技能来解决新的问题、创造新的产品和服务。例如,在建筑工程中,工程师可以使用计算机辅助设计(CAD)软件来设计建筑物的结构和布局;在环境工程中,工程师可以编写模拟程序来预测和评估环境影响。编程技能使工程师能够不断创新和改进工程实践。
综上所述,编程和工程师有着紧密的联系。编程为工程师提供了解决问题、实现自动化和智能化、学习和创新的工具和平台。对于现代工程师来说,掌握编程技能已经成为一项必备的能力,能够帮助他们更好地应对复杂的工程挑战和推动工程技术的发展。
1年前 -
编程和工程师之间有着密切的联系。下面是五个方面的联系:
-
工程师需要编程技能:现代工程师在工作中经常需要使用计算机软件来设计、模拟和优化各种系统。编程技能可以帮助工程师实现这些任务,例如使用CAD软件进行设计、使用MATLAB进行数值分析和模拟、使用Python进行数据处理等。编程技能可以帮助工程师更高效地完成工作,提高工作质量和生产效率。
-
编程可以用于自动化和控制系统:工程师经常需要设计和实施自动化和控制系统来监控和控制各种工业和工程过程。编程是实现这些系统的基础,工程师可以使用编程语言编写控制算法和逻辑,并将其应用于实际的控制硬件中。通过编程,工程师可以实现高度自动化的系统,提高生产效率和质量。
-
编程用于数据分析和建模:工程师经常需要进行数据分析和建模来优化系统设计和工艺流程。编程语言是进行这些任务的重要工具,工程师可以使用编程语言编写数据处理和分析的算法,并将其应用于实际的数据集中。通过编程,工程师可以更好地理解和优化系统的性能,提高生产效率和质量。
-
编程用于软件开发:工程师经常需要开发和维护各种工程软件,例如仿真软件、控制软件、数据分析软件等。编程是软件开发的核心技能,工程师需要使用编程语言来实现软件的功能和逻辑。通过编程,工程师可以开发出高质量、高性能的工程软件,满足工程实践的需求。
-
编程促进工程师的创新能力:编程是一种创造性的工作,可以激发工程师的创新能力。通过编程,工程师可以实现自己的想法和创意,开发出新的工程解决方案。编程可以帮助工程师更好地理解问题,提出创新的解决方案,并将其转化为实际的工程产品。
综上所述,编程和工程师之间有着紧密的联系。编程技能可以帮助工程师更高效地完成工作,实现自动化和控制系统,进行数据分析和建模,开发工程软件,以及激发创新能力。因此,掌握编程技能对于现代工程师来说非常重要。
1年前 -
-
编程和工程师之间有着密切的联系。编程是工程师在实施工程项目时所使用的一种技术手段。工程师通过编写代码来实现设计和构建复杂的系统和软件。编程使工程师能够将设计和理论转化为实际可行的产品和解决方案。
以下是编程和工程师之间联系的几个方面:
-
自动化和控制系统:工程师使用编程技术来开发自动化和控制系统。这些系统可以用于监测和控制各种设备和过程,例如工厂生产线、机器人和航空航天设备。编程使工程师能够编写逻辑和算法,以实现自动化和控制系统的预期功能。
-
系统设计和集成:工程师使用编程技术来设计和集成复杂的系统。这些系统可以包括软件应用程序、网络架构、数据库系统等。编程使工程师能够创建系统的框架和结构,并将各个组件集成在一起,以实现系统的功能和性能要求。
-
数据分析和模型开发:工程师使用编程技术来进行数据分析和模型开发。通过编程,工程师可以处理大量的数据,并使用算法和模型来提取有价值的信息和洞察。这些信息可以用于决策支持、优化设计和改进系统性能。
-
软件开发和测试:工程师使用编程技术来开发和测试软件应用程序。他们编写代码来实现软件的功能,并进行测试以确保软件的质量和可靠性。编程使工程师能够设计和实现高效、可维护和易于使用的软件。
-
项目管理和团队协作:工程师使用编程技术来进行项目管理和团队协作。他们可以编写脚本和工具来自动化任务,提高效率和减少错误。编程还使工程师能够与团队成员共享代码和协同开发项目。
总之,编程是工程师实施工程项目的重要工具和技术。它使工程师能够将设计和理论转化为实际可行的产品和解决方案,并提高工程项目的效率和质量。编程技术的应用范围广泛,涉及到各个领域和行业,是工程师必备的技能之一。
1年前 -